Mikel Arteta has confirmed a triple injury boost for Arsenal, with Gabriel Magalhaes, Declan Rice and Leandro Trossard available for selection for the Champions League quater-final at Sporting CP. There was, however, confirmation that Jurrien Timber and Bukayo Saka will not be fit for the game.
Arsenal take on Sporting in the first leg of the quarter-final on Tuesday night (8pm kick-off), with the second leg taking place just over a week later at the Emirates Stadium.
Ahead of the game, there were injury doubts over Gabriel, Rice, Saka, Piero Hincapie, Jurrien Timber and Leandro Trossard. Eberechi Eze and Mikel Merino are ruled out of the tie through injury.

When asked in his pre-match press conference if Gabriel, Rice and Trossard were available for the game, Arteta said: "Yes, yes and yes."
But giving an update on Timber and Saka, the Arsenal boss added: "They haven't travelled and not ready yet, hopefully for the weekend if everything goes well."
Timber has been struggling with injury for the last three weeks, and did look to be in contention to return vs Southampton. But he wasn't included in the squad for the FA Cup clash, with eyes now on a return at the weekend ahead of the second leg.

It was a similar situation for Saka, who was absent from the squad vs Southampton after returning early from England duty. He will now miss the first leg against Sporting.
One player who is expected to start in striker Viktor Gyokeres, who will come up against his former club.
The forward joined Arsenal from Sporting in a deal worth around £55 million in the summer. Arteta has revealed he has spoken to Gyokeres to try and get an insight into Arsenal's opponents.
"Of course I did, to understand the dynamics the culture and to have more information about them that we can use in our favour," he said.
"A lot of qualities, what they are doing is remarkable. The record they have at home is amazing."
Opening up on how the Gyokeres transfer came about, Arteta said: He's been on the radar for years, but more recent moments when we look at it, he was one of the top targets was around December of last year.
"When we had the issue with Kai [Havertz], and he became one of the main candidates."
